Mapou Yanga-Mbiwa out for three weeks

Roma defender Mapou Yanga-Mbiwa is expected to be sidelined for around three weeks with a thigh injury.

Roma defender Mapou Yanga-Mbiwa has been ruled out of action for up to three weeks with a thigh injury.

The Frenchman, who is on loan from Newcastle United, suffered the problem during his country's 1-1 draw with Albania on Friday.

Yanga-Mbiwa, 25, is expected to be sidelined until around the middle of November.

The centre-back has made 13 appearances in all competitions for Roma so far this season.
